…In horticulture, irises are broadly divided into two groups: bulbous irises and rhizomatous irises. (1) Bulbous irises The representative of the bulbous irises group, Dutch iris I. hollandica Hort. (illustration), was created in the Netherlands in the early 1900s by crossbreeding Spanish iris I. xiphium L. (English name: Spanish iris) with other species, and cut flowers are in high demand around the world. In Japan, it is sometimes simply called "iris." … *Some of the terminology explanations that mention "Dutch iris" are listed below. Source | Heibonsha World Encyclopedia 2nd Edition | Information |
